Abstract
A GPS device comprising: a first circuit arranged to receive at least one first signal and arranged to output first timing information dependent on the first signal; a second circuit arranged to receive at least one second signal and arranged to output second timing information dependent of the second signal; and a third circuit arranged to determine timing information of the device. The third circuit is arranged to receive at least one of the first and second timing information, and further arranged to produce third timing information dependent on at least one of the first and second signals. The third circuit further is arranged to produce a location estimate dependent on the first and third timing information. The third timing information is initially synchronized to the first timing information and maintained substantially synchronized to the at least one first signal using the second timing information.
